About 2 Hollands Way

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

2 Hollands Way is an end-of-terrace house in Kegworth, Derby, Derby (DE74 2GQ). It has a recorded floor area of 64 m² (around 689 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2003-2006 and council tax band B. At 64 m² this is the 17th smallest of 41 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 51–145 m². The building's EPC ratings span C to B, with this unit at the bottom. The latest certificate (September 2017) shows a C (score 75), near the top of the C band. Main heating runs on electricity.

Untraded for 20 years, with the last transfer in December 2005. Today's modelled estimate of £137,000 is 19.4% above the 2005 sale price.
